在存在NAMESPACE的情况下,另一个问题是你试图从包foo运行一个未导出的函数。

例如(人为,我知道,但是):> mod  plot.prcomp(mod)Error: could not find function "plot.prcomp"

首先,你不应该直接调用S3方法,但假设plot.prcomp在包foo中实际上是一些有用的内部函数。如果您知道自己在做什么,要调用此类函数需要使用:::。您还需要知道找到该函数的命名空间。使用getAnywhere()我们发现该函数在包统计中:> getAnywhere(plot.prcomp)A single object matching ‘plot.prcomp’ was found

It was found in the following places

registered S3 method for plot from namespace stats

namespace:stats

with valuefunction (x, main = deparse(substitute(x)), ...) screeplot.default(x, main = main, ...)

所以我们现在可以直接调用它:> stats:::plot.prcomp(mod)

我plot.prcomp只是用一个例子来说明目的。在正常使用中,您不应该像这样调用S3方法。但正如我所说,如果您要调用的函数存在(例如它可能是隐藏的实用程序函数),但是在a中namespace,R将报告它无法找到该函数,除非您告诉它要查找哪个命名空间。

将此与以下内容进行比较: stats::plot.prcomp 上述操作失败,因为在stats使用时plot.prcomp,它不会导出,stats因为错误正确地告诉我们:错误:'plot.prcomp'不是'namespace:stats'中的导出对象

这记录如下:pkg :: name返回命名空间pkg中导出的变量名的值,而pkg ::: name返回内部变量名的值。

r语言lm函数找不到对象_错误:在R中找不到函数....相关推荐

  1. R 语言怎么保存工作目录到当前路径_第一讲 R基本介绍及安装

    今天是第一讲,带你走进R的世界.R是用于统计计算和数据可视化的免费且功能强大的编程语言.R可用于计算各种经典的统计检验,以及各种最新的统计学建议方法.以小编使用R近10年的经验来看,论文中有什么最新最 ...

  2. python输入英文句子、找最长单词_在输入fi中找出句子中的最大和最小单词数

    我有一个问题,要求我找出文本文件中单词的最小和最大数量.我已经完成了五个问题中的三个,剩下的两个是关于最小值和最大值的问题,我对此没有任何解决办法.以下是我的代码:感谢您的帮助lines, blank ...

  3. R语言ggplot2可视化:可视化堆叠的直方图、在bin中的每个分组部分添加数值标签、使用position_stack函数设置

    R语言ggplot2可视化:可视化堆叠的直方图.在bin中的每个分组部分添加数值标签.使用position_stack函数设置 目录

  4. R语言可视化散点图(scatter plot)、并在散点图中叠加回归曲线、叠加lowess拟合曲线(linear and lowess fit lines)、使用plot、line、abline函数

    R语言可视化散点图(scatter plot).并在散点图中叠加回归曲线.叠加lowess拟合曲线(linear and lowess fit lines).使用plot函数.line函数和ablin ...

  5. R语言ggplot2可视化并添加特定区间的回归线、R原生plot函数可视化并添加特定区间的回归线:Add Regression Line Between Certain Limits

    R语言ggplot2可视化并添加特定区间的回归线.R原生plot函数可视化并添加特定区间的回归线:Add Regression Line Between Certain Limits 目录

  6. R语言ggplot2可视化为组合图添加综合图例实战:使用ggpubr包ggarrange函数实现综合图例、使用patchwork包实现综合图例

    R语言ggplot2可视化为组合图添加综合图例实战:使用ggpubr包ggarrange函数实现综合图例.使用patchwork包实现综合图例 目录

  7. R语言按组聚合求和实战(sum a variable by group):使用aggregate函数按组聚合求和、使用tapply函数按组聚合求和、按组聚合求和(使用dplyr包)

    R语言按组聚合求和实战(sum a variable by group):使用aggregate函数按组聚合求和.使用tapply函数按组聚合求和.按组聚合求和(使用dplyr包) 目录

  8. R语言使用lightgbm包构建多分类的LightGBM模型、caret包的confusionMatrix函数输出多分类混淆矩阵(包含:准确率及其置信区、p值、Kappa、特异度、灵敏度等)

    R语言使用lightgbm包构建多分类的LightGBM模型.caret包的confusionMatrix函数输出多分类混淆矩阵(包含:准确率及其置信区.p值.Kappa.特异度.灵敏度等) 目录

  9. R语言使用pdf函数将可视化图像结果保存到pdf文件中、使用pdf函数打开图像设备、使用dev.off函数关闭图像设备、自定义width参数和height参数指定图像的宽度和高度

    R语言使用pdf函数将可视化图像结果保存到pdf文件中.使用pdf函数打开图像设备.使用dev.off函数关闭图像设备.自定义width参数和height参数指定图像的宽度和高度 目录

最新文章

  1. python3.6for循环_使用parser_args值输入for循环(python3.6)
  2. mysql olap 工具_OLAP分析工具之Presto
  3. (十四)json、pickle与shelve模块
  4. 洛谷P4301 [CQOI2013]新Nim游戏
  5. opencv镜像_DX200操作要领—PAM与镜像平移变换(三十八)
  6. SSM中抛出异常 java.lang.ClassNotFoundException: org.springframework.web.context.ContextLoad
  7. Hive是如何让MapReduce实现SQL操作的?
  8. Win11系统无法安装GPT分区的解决方法
  9. Spring Boot 2.0 开源项目--云收藏。收藏你所喜欢的一切。
  10. C# Base64编码
  11. Linux学习笔记---使用MfgTool工具烧写自己的系统(二)
  12. java math mod_java8 Math新增方法介绍
  13. 获取ItemsControl中当前item的binding数据
  14. Android中类似Linux下ldd分析可执行文件和动态库对库的依赖
  15. 单片机学习(点阵LED及多模块同时实现)
  16. 笔记本计算机怎么进入安全模式启动,笔记本电脑如何进入安全模式
  17. 51NOD 1432 独木舟
  18. 最新彩虹Ds发卡源码模板-Cool模板源码
  19. linux vad检测,VAD树结构体的属性以及遍历
  20. 点餐系统mysql设计,外卖点餐系统数据库设计.doc

热门文章

  1. 解决“A problem has been encountered while loading the setup components. Canceling setup.”的问题
  2. 创东方钱伟:蚁视和极米背后的投资人
  3. python程序设置头像_Django+JS 实现点击头像即可更改头像的方法示例
  4. IntelliJ IDEA 实用操作教程
  5. arp 华为 查看 路由器_华为路由器工作运行状态查看
  6. 调用百度API实现漫画脸生成
  7. html5多个图片位置_关于 HTML5 你需要了解的基础知识
  8. tablewidget 多行表头_Qt GUI图形图像开发之QT表格控件QTableView,QTableWidget复杂表头(多行表头) 及冻结、固定特定的行的详细方法与实例...
  9. 【web前端】CSS笔记小结 盒子模型+PS基操+样例(Day 3+部分Day 4)
  10. 长度质量计量单位换算